Why Lithium Storage Dominates Canberra''s Energy Transition

As Australia''s capital pushes toward 100% renewable energy by 2045, lithium-ion battery systems have emerged as the backbone of Canberra''s power infrastructure. Unlike traditional lead-acid batteries, these solutions offer:

  • 85-95% round-trip efficiency rates
  • 10-15 year operational lifespan
  • Scalability from 100kW to 100MW installations

"The ACT government''s latest energy report shows lithium storage projects reduced peak demand charges by 40% for commercial users in 2023."

Key Procurement Considerations

When planning your lithium energy storage purchase project in Canberra, three factors demand special attention:

1. System Sizing Strategies

Most commercial projects in the capital region opt for modular systems that allow capacity expansion. A typical 500kW system can power:

  • 50 medium-sized offices for 8 hours
  • 1 suburban shopping center through peak hours
  • 3 electric bus charging stations simultaneously

Real-World Success Stories

Let''s examine two Canberra-based implementations:

Case Study: Canberra Hospital Storage System

This 2MW/4MWh installation achieved:

  • 28% reduction in monthly energy costs
  • 72-hour backup capability for critical care units
  • 7-year ROI through demand charge management

Pro tip: Many projects combine solar PV with lithium storage – like the Belconnen Community Center''s hybrid system that cut grid dependence by 65%.

FAQ Section

What''s the typical payback period for commercial systems?

Most Canberra projects achieve ROI within 4-7 years through energy arbitrage and demand charge reduction.

How does temperature affect performance?

Modern lithium systems maintain 90% efficiency in Canberra''s temperature range (-5°C to 40°C) with built-in thermal management.

Are there recycling options?

Yes, ACT-approved recyclers currently recover 95% of battery materials through closed-loop processes.
